Donald Glover to star as Simba in 'Lion King' remake
Donald Glover will play Simba in the remake of 'Lion King'.
Disney's new animated movie will be directed by Jon Favreau, who took to Twitter to announce that the 33-year-old actor will play the king of Pride Lands jungle. "I just can't wait to be king. #Simba," wrote Favreau, along side Donald's photo.

'The Jungle Book' helmer also declared that James Earl Jones will reprise his role as Mufasa, the beloved father character, he voiced in the 1994 animated original.

He tweeted Jones' photo which he captioned as, 'Looking forward to working with this legend. #Mufasa'

Glover is currently filming the young Han Solo Star Wars spin-off in which he plays Lando Calrissian. Also, Jones reprised his voice work as Darth Vader in December's 'Star Wars: A Rogue One Story'.
